Newton and the Counterfeiter by Thomas Levenson
When William Chaloner began his extraordinary life as a counterfeiter of the King's (rather suspect) currency he probably never envisioned his bravado taking him almost to the position of running the Mint itself. A self-proclaimed 'expert', he hoped to remove the current incumbent after questioning and deriding his abilities. Unfortunately for Chaloner the new incumbent was Isaac Newton, forced by finances into a public position and not in the mood to have his abilities questioned.
